There are a number of ways to order your repeat prescriptions...
Regardless of the method used to order your medication, your prescription will be sent via the Electronic Prescription Service to your nominated pharmacy. As soon as your doctor has electronically signed your prescription it automatically goes to your nominated pharmacy, However, please note you need to allow time for the pharmacy to prepare your prescription before going to collect it.
If you are requesting a prescription early due to holiday, please can you provide us with your date of departure, how long you are away for and whether you will be in the UK or abroad as this will enable us to process your prescription appropriately.
Please allow at least 48 hours, excluding weekends and Bank Holidays, for your request to be processed by the surgery, you need to allow additional time for your chosen pharmacy to dispense your medication, it is therefore advisable to order your prescription one week before you run out of your medication. Please note this is for items that your doctor has authorised for repeat prescribing only. Items that are not on your repeat list may take longer.
